            Ethereum Dencun Upgrade Targets March 13 for Proto-Danksharding Debut on Mainnet

            Future plans include the potential integration of “Verkle Trees”.

            9 Feb 2024 | 3 min read

            Ethereum developers have officially announced March 13 as the target date for the much-anticipated Ethereum Dencun upgrade, marking a significant milestone in the blockchain’s evolution since April 2023. The upgrade, highlighted for its groundbreaking “proto-danksharding” feature, aims to streamline layer-2 transactions and enhance data availability on Ethereum. After a successful deployment on the Holesky testnet, the final of three test networks, Ethereum is gearing up for substantial changes.

            The decision to set the March 13 target date was communicated during the all-core developers consensus layer call 127, just a day after the seamless integration of the upgrade on the Holesky testnet. Parithosh Jayanthi, a devops engineer at the Ethereum Foundation, expressed enthusiasm, stating, “It’s great to see years worth of effort finally being scheduled for Ethereum mainnet.”

            The Ethereum Dencun upgrade introduces “proto-danksharding,” a feature dedicated to reducing transaction costs on auxiliary layer-2 networks built atop Ethereum. The successful execution on the Holesky testnet without issues has paved the way for the mainnet deployment, set to occur at slot 8626176, estimated for 13:55 UTC on March 13. However, the date awaits developer ratification and confirmation via GitHub.

            Proto-danksharding represents the initial phase of the broader “danksharding” technical feature aimed at scaling the Ethereum blockchain. This innovation introduces “data blobs,” a novel category for storing data, enabling a new transaction class known as “proto-danksharding.” Beyond cost reduction for transactions, this feature is poised to enhance the availability of data on Ethereum, benefiting projects like Celestia, Avail, and EigenDA.

            Despite the delay from the original end-of-2023 target, Ethereum developers are optimistic about the Ethereum Dencun upgrade, viewing it as a crucial element of the blockchain’s roadmap. The upcoming Prague/Electra hard fork is already on their agenda, potentially incorporating “Verkle Trees,” a new data structure designed to facilitate efficient storage of large data amounts without compromising the ability to validate blocks.

            Thus, Ethereum Dencun upgrade, with the groundbreaking proto-danksharding feature, is scheduled for activation on March 13, marking a pivotal moment in Ethereum’s evolution and setting the stage for a new era of improved scalability and functionality. The successful test deployments, including on the Goerli, Sepolia, and Holesky testnets, indicate the careful preparation undertaken to ensure a seamless transition to the main network.
